Output 30098619b60c96651365dcb00704ca13171bd945f5e5abe3e303ae59def1424d:0

value
80355501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f73172fbd94d37de13f4e6e37918b633b7c476b OP_EQUAL
address
MNSFYZgoW8qtgUgknS9gypnMuUVWdC6odw
transaction
30098619b60c96651365dcb00704ca13171bd945f5e5abe3e303ae59def1424d
spent
true